R.D. Olson Construction Completes "Spa in the Mall"

  BREA, Calif-- R.D. Olson Construction has completed the renovation of an inoperative theater and transformed it into the Glen Ivy Day Spa. The spa, located at 1065 Brea Mall, #1001 in Brea, is sure to be a welcomed destination for shoppers and relaxation-seekers alike.

In providing pre construction and general contracting services, Irvine-based Olson renovated the existing space into a 14,000-square-foot luxury spa with twenty-one treatment rooms including 14 massage areas, five facial suites, men’s and women’s locker rooms, two Roman baths, two steam rooms, and a total of eight manicure and pedicure stations. Project costs totaled $2.3 million.

“Building a spa in a mall is a new concept that is catching on quickly,” said Dennis Reyling, president, R.D. Olson Construction. “We are pleased to work on a project, which will set the standards for this new trend.”

The Glen Ivy Day Spa is an offshoot of its parent company, Glen Ivy Hot Springs Spa in Corona. Originally dating back to the 1870s, Glen Ivy Hot Springs Spa was re-built in the 1980s and has since been rated as one of the country’s finest. Much like the Corona spa, the Glen Ivy Day Spa at Brea Mall will offer peaceful garden settings with trickling waterfalls and as much lush foliage as the indoor setting will allow. A large greenhouse room including a fireplace encased by bookshelves will serve as a retreat where guests can lift their feet and relax, or enjoy a beverage, snack or lunch. The Glen Ivy Day Spa also will be home to a Spa Lifestyle Store, a retail innovation especially designed for the Brea Mall location.

Just outside the spa’s entrance is an elaborate copper fountain. The spa’s only connection to the mall’s interior is the one large show window offering a hint of the many luxuries within. Irvine-based T. S. Voelker Architecture designed the spa, using a palette of natural finishes in an effort to replicate the unpretentious natural luxury of the original Glen Ivy Hot Springs Spa. Stone flooring, patina copper roof elements, and natural woods are used to achieve an earthly flavor.
